Sharon Willson Email

Reimbursement Officer . Center For Life Resources

Current Roles

Employees:
115
Revenue:
$31.1M
About
Center For Life Resources is a hospital & health care company based out of 901 Avenue B, Brownwood, Texas, United States.
Center For Life Resources Address
901 Avenue B
Brownwood, TX
United States
Center For Life Resources Email
Center For Life Resources Phone Numbers
415-732-8671

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.